Paris Court Rules: LERCO to Pay $140 Million to NOC, Rejects $1 Billion Claim by Emirati Partner

The Supreme Court of Paris issued a final ruling rejecting all demands of the Emirati partner for compensation of approximately $1 billion from the National Oil Corporation. The court also ordered LERCO to pay National Oil Corporation around $140 million for past oil invoices that LERCO refused to settle.

Former Chairman of the National Oil Corporation, Mustafa Sanallah, stated that this final ruling confirms the arbitration ruling issued in January 2018 and the Paris Court of Appeals ruling in February 2021 in the “LERCO No. 1” case. This unappealable ruling affirms the justice of the National Oil Corporation’s position and the illegitimacy of the claims made by the Emirati partner.
